Players set up two sets of lines which are facing one another.
The two lines which start without the ball both sprint into the middle of the area to receive the pass from the left. After receiving the ball they then pass it straight over and follow their pass.
The front players in the two lines which don't have a ball now both drive into the middle to receive the pass from the left and then throw the ball straight over and follow their pass.
The ball should be passed in front of the driving player so that their arms are outstretched to receive the ball.
Do not let players rush the pass, ensure all passes are completed successfully and that chest passes should be fast and flat.
